Transaction 59e858c63279dfb900eb52be92ff9503f8156b6a89bfd14002c958fdd60f2a1b

1 Input
2 Outputs
  • 59e858c63279dfb900eb52be92ff9503f8156b6a89bfd14002c958fdd60f2a1b:0
  • value  430874
    address  3K4nfdwiPwQaBRYddTo3KxGdYZ3YbzjjQC
  • 59e858c63279dfb900eb52be92ff9503f8156b6a89bfd14002c958fdd60f2a1b:1
  • value  4676059
    address  1Dfe95zGvADZcZxYEbcrYDFYTwL2HEBUoe